#d650a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d650a2 is composed of 83.9% red, 31.4%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 323.3 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 57.6%. #d650a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#ad0045.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d650a2 color description : Moderate pink.
#d650a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d650a2 has RGB values of R:214, G:80,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.24,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14045346.

Shades and Tints of #d650a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10040b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d650a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949293 is the less saturated color, while #f72fa9 is the most saturated one.
